Miami’s offense had high expectations in 2023 despite having some major questions along the wide receiver. However, that ended up not being the unit’s biggest weakness on the field. Surprisingly, the passing game and a lack of efficiency are what held Shannon Dawson‘s unit back.

What helps spread things out on offense? Having a quarterback that can use his legs both in the scripted and unscripted run game. Washington State transfer Cam Ward can check that box for Miami.

Regardless of what new spread looks that Miami will try to utilize, this offense still needs a quarterback who can make quick reads and get the ball out on time. Playing with correct timing is essential in this pro-style scheme that has a ton of moving parts. Cam Ward will have to prove that he has the accuracy long-term to efficiently run the offense but this is a quarterback that has been well-coached and looks comfortable making reads.
